在当今的互联网时代,各种编程语言和框架层出不穷,而PHP和JSP作为两种流行的服务器端脚本语言,它们在各自的领域都有着广泛的应用。有时候,我们可能会遇到需要在同一个项目中整合PHP和JSP的需求。PHP如何部署到JSP项目实例呢?本文将为您详细解析这一过程。
一、项目背景
假设我们有一个基于JSP的项目,它主要负责展示一些静态页面和与数据库的交互。随着业务的发展,我们可能需要引入一些PHP功能,例如处理一些复杂的业务逻辑或者与第三方API进行交互。这时,我们就需要将PHP部署到JSP项目实例中。

二、技术选型
在部署PHP到JSP项目实例之前,我们需要先确定一些技术选型:
| 技术 | 说明 |
|---|---|
| 服务器 | Apache、Nginx等 |
| PHP | PHP7.4以上版本 |
| JSP | JavaEE8以上版本 |
| 数据库 | MySQL、Oracle等 |
三、部署步骤
1. 安装PHP环境
我们需要在服务器上安装PHP环境。以下以Apache服务器为例:
1. 下载PHP安装包:[PHP官网](https://www.php.net/downloads.php)
2. 解压安装包:`tar -zxvf php-7.4.30.tar.gz`
3. 编译安装:`./configure --with-apache --enable-zip --enable-mysqlnd`
4. 安装:`make && make install`
5. 配置Apache服务器:在`httpd.conf`文件中添加以下配置:
```bash
LoadModule php7_module modules/libphp7.so
AddType application/x-httpd-php .php
```
6. 重启Apache服务器:`apachectl restart`
2. 配置PHP与JSP的交互
为了使PHP和JSP能够互相调用,我们需要在JSP页面中引入PHP代码,并在PHP代码中调用JSP页面。
1. 在JSP页面中引入PHP代码:
```jsp
<%@ page contentType="







